CLIMATE

  METEO GUADELOUPE : CLIC

Very sunny, because of the tropical climate (though a sun-block protection is recommanded the first days) but also rain, sometimes characterized by a heavy rain season. The temputure of the sea is soft which can grimp up to over 29 degrees C° (between July and October). The temperature never goes under 24 degrees C° during the dry season. There are 2 seasons on the island: from February till April, a dry season. May/June and September/October are the most confortable periods and enjoy the Alizes. Often it can rain in Pointe à Pitre while you are swimming in the sun in Sainte-Anne! All year long, sunrise is between 5:00 and 6:00 a.m. and sunset between 18:00 p.m. and 19:00 p.m. Bring a special lotion with you to protect yourself against the moustiquo’s. There are no dangerous animals such as snakes, scorpions in Guadeloupe, it’s a real little paradise!
